AMD forecasts $2 billion sales of AI chips, helping shares reboundedit

Chip designer Advanced Micro Devices (AMD.O) on Tuesday forecast $2 billion in sales in 2024 from a chip that aims to compete with Nvidia (NVDA.O) in the artificial intelligence (AI) market, helping shares recover after a quarterly outlook missed expectations.

Nvidia’s $5 Billion of China Orders in Limbo After Latest U.S. Curbsedit

The rules now cover most of the high performance AI and datacenter chips from Nvidia, Intel and Advanced Micro Devices. Chinese companies will have to rely on inventory, use a larger number of less advanced chips or find other workarounds.

L&T Invests Rs 830 cr to Foray into Fabless Semicon Chip Design Bizedit

Engineering major Larsen and Toubro (L&T) is foraying into fabless semiconductor chip design, making an initial investment of ?830 crore to set up a wholly owned unit.
